Mining of copper ores is carried out using one of two methods. Underground mining is achieved by sinking shafts to the appropriate levels and then driving horizontal tunnels, called adits, to reach the ore. Underground mining is, however, relatively expensive and is generally limited to rich ores. El Teniente, in Chile, is the world''s largest ...

Dec 30, 2018· The ability to extract copper from ore bodies was welldeveloped by 3000 BC and critical to the growing use of copper and copper alloys. Lake Van, in presentday Armenia, was the most likely source of copper ore for Mesopotamian metalsmiths who used the metal to produce pots, trays, saucers, and drinking vessels.

Copper has been an essential material to man since prehistoric times. In fact, one of the major "ages" or stages of human history is named for a copper alloy, bronze. Copper mining in the United States has been a major industry since the rise of the northern Michigan copper district in the 1840s. In 2017 the United States produced million metric tonnes of copper, worth 8 billion, making it the world''s fourth largest copper producer, after Chile, China, and was produced from 23 mines in the US. Something that can be collected from the mine dumps are specimens of the mineral product that the mine produced as well as associated minerals. In the case of the Michigan copper mines you can find native copper and silver, as well as datolite, epidote, calcite, .

Copper Industry. Early Andean copper mining was prompted by the need to develop symbolic objects that served political power, the display of social status, and communication of religious belief. Goldplated and alloyed copper objects were common in the preInca Chavín culture of about 1000 bce.

The earliest known metalworking in North America begins when Native peoples start mining copper on the Keweenaw Peninsula. Digging pits and using heavy stones to break waste rock away from copper masses, they fashion bracelets, beads, tools, fishhooks and other items for trade. Objects made of ...
